After nine rounds of voting in the General Assembly the election of a non permanent member of the UN Security Council was inconclusive. Despite getting 113 votes, against Slovenia's 77, Azerbaijan fell short of the two thirds majority required. The voting resumes on Monday.
21 October: The OSCE Minsk Group co-Chair, representing Russia, the US and France, have started a visit to the Karabakh conflict zone. They are expected to cross the line of contact seperating the two sides on Saturday. (agencies)
The Russian President said that ‘the resolution of this complex but solvable problem depends on the good will of the two peoples and the two presidents, on whether they listen more to each other, make concessions and find a compromise”.
